Ideas Worth Spreading With TED Talks in your classroom, your learners can hear inspiring people share ideas that can change the world. Now your learners will satisfy their curiosity about 21st century topics and share their Ideas Worth Spreading in English. Keynote (page 54), World English, Second Edition (page 60) and 21st Century Reading (page 94) now feature Ted Talks! Each TED Talk is supported in the Student Book The authentic language presented in TED Talks is supported by a one-of-a-kind instructional design that uses images from the TED stage to teach and reinforce key language and concepts. National Geographic Learning is proud to announce a new partnership with TED in English Language Teaching, helping us to provide curious minds with authentic, compelling materials in the classroom. Alongside rich, National Geographic resources and one-of-a-kind instructional support, powerful TED Talks provide an engaging springboard for learners to share ideas in English.
